Chili Garlic Prawns Recipe #380067

What could be simpler than this recipe? I like to serve it with rice and an Asian vegetable mixture (I get mine from the frozen food section of my grocery store).
by TasteTester

21 min | 15 min prep

SERVES 4

  1. (If serving with a frozen vegetable mixture and rice, start cooking them while you peel and devein the shrimp. When the vegetables and rice are done, keep them warm and start cooking the prawns -- it will take only a few minutes.).
  2. Heat oil in wok or skillet. Add prawns and stir-fry until just pink.
  3. Add chili garlic sauce and stir-fry until prawns are completely cooked, just about 2-4 minutes more, depending on the size of your shrimp. Sprinkle with green onion and serve.
